SAUSAGE MEAT AND SAUERKRAUT CASSEROLE
Provided by Florence Fabricant
Categories dinner, casseroles, main course
Time 2h20m
Yield 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Cover mushrooms with boiling water and set aside to soften.
- Cook the salt pork in a large, heavy sauce pan until golden brown. Add onions and saute until soft but not brown. Stir in the apple and saute another minute or two.
- Rinse the sauerkraut in cold water and squeeze very dry. Add sauerkraut to the saucepan and cook for several minutes. Stir in the tomatoes, the mushrooms and their liquid and simmer for 15 minutes.
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Season the sauerkraut mixture with salt and pepper. Spread one-third of the sauerkraut mixture in a large casserole, about 3-quart capacity. Cover with half the meats, both the sausage and the cooked meat. Cover with half remaining sauerkraut, the rest of the meat and then the last of the sauerkraut. Arrange the apple wedges in a pattern on top, place a bay leaf in center and pour the wine over it. Bake covered for 1 1/2 hours.
- Serve with boiled potatoes and pickles.

POTATO & SAUERKRAUT BAKE
Inspired by food I grew up eating. The sauerkraut and fennel makes this potato dish a very European-tasting side that goes great with sausage. Just be sure to squeeze out all that liquid from the kraut.
Provided by rpgaymer
Categories Potato
Time 1h30m
Yield 6 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400°F.
- Heat the butter in a heavy pot over medium heat. Add the potatoes, and brown them a bit for 10 minutes, while sitrring every now and then. Add salt and pepper to taste.
- Add the onion, fennel, celery and carrots to the pot; stir and cook for 5 minutes longer. I add just a bit of salt & pepper here too.
- Remove from heat and stir in the sauerkraut. Tranfer mixture to a greased or sprayed 9x13" casserole dish.
- Bake for one hour, and stir every 15 minutes so everything gets nicely browned and nothing burns. I add a small bit of salt and pepper every time I stir as well.
- Remove from oven and let cool for at least 10 minutes before serving.

BARBECUE SAUERKRAUT BAKE
The combination of barbecue and sauerkraut might sound strange, but it's very tasty! We love the combination. :)
Provided by Julesong
Categories Vegetable
Time 45m
Yield 4-6 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
- In a sa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ter and olive oil together, then add the onion and sauté until lightly browned, about 5 to 7 minutes.
- Reduce the temperature to low, add the garlic, catsup, brown sugar, lemon juice, Worcestershire, mustard, and Tabasco or hot sauce, and simmer for 10 minutes; add the shredded cooked meat, remove from heat, and set aside.
- In a colander rinse the sauerkraut well under running water, then set aside to let drain.
- In a lightly sprayed casserole dish, pour the meat and barbecue sauce mixture, then spread the sauerkraut over the meat.
- In a bowl, combine the breadcrumbs and Parmesan.
- Sprinkle crumb mixture over the sauerkraut, lightly spray with olive oil or pan spray, then bake at 350 degrees F for 20 to 25 minutes or until crumb topping is golden brown and crisped to desired texture.
- Serve as is or over toast (dark rye is good!) or toasted hamburger buns.
- Note: you can put a layer of barbecued beans under the shredded meat, if desired; also, you can use commercially prepared barbecued sauce instead of making your own as above (about 1 1/4 cup of sauce).
